2026 Hyundai Palisade Seat Belt Recall
2026 HYUNDAI PALISADE: SEAT BELTS: REAR/OTHER:BUCKLE ASSEMBLY
Updated March 20, 2026
The third-row driver-side seat belt buckle wiring in certain 2026 Hyundai Palisade and Palisade Hybrid vehicles may fail, causing the dashboard indicator to stay lit even when the seat belt is unfastened. This prevents you from knowing if a rear passenger is unbelted in a crash.
Is the Hyundai Motor America recalled? Yes. This product was recalled by NHTSA on March 20, 2026. Details below.
What is recalled
2026 Hyundai Palisade and 2026 Hyundai Palisade Hybrid vehicles equipped with Limited or Calligraphy trim packages.
Am I affected
You are affected if you own a 2026 Hyundai Palisade or Palisade Hybrid with Limited or Calligraphy trim, and your vehicle's VIN is listed in the recall. Check your VIN on NHTSA.gov or contact Hyundai at 1-855-371-9460 to confirm.
What to do right now
Contact Hyundai customer service at 1-855-371-9460 to schedule a free dealer appointment. A dealer will install a wiring harness extension and replace the seat belt assembly as needed, at no cost.
Contact: Hyundai Motor America
The hazard
A faulty seat belt status indicator may fail to alert occupants to an unfastened seat belt, increasing the risk of injury.
